The Seaward Nelson 27 E20 is a new addition to the Seaward range and will make its world debut at the upcoming Southampton Boat Show. The 27 has a longer wheelhouse than the Seaward 25 and a longer hull with a built-in transom platform. Boasting a full-length berth and the option of a galley in the wheelhouse, the 27 shares the same sea boat capability and handling as the other models in the range.
Seaward will also be exhibiting the Seaward 39 at the show and will have the 42 and the 25 available to view locally.
